Definitions:

Voir Dire

A preliminary examination of prospective jurors or witnesses to determine their competency and suitability to serve in a legal case.

Paralegal

A professional trained in legal matters who assists attorneys in their work but is not licensed to practice law themselves.

Attorney

A legal professional authorized to practice law, representing clients in legal matters and providing advice.

Alternate Jurors

Additional jurors selected during a trial who will step in should any of the main jurors be unable to continue serving.
